Understand common terms used in real estate closings in Hidden Valley Lake and the surrounding area.
Escrow is a neutral holding process for funds and documents until conditions are satisfied and the closing can proceed.
Title insurance protects against losses from defects in the property’s title that were not found in the title search.
A deed is a legal document that transfers ownership from seller to buyer.
Closing costs are the fees and charges due at the time of transfer, including recording fees, title premiums, and lender charges.

Closing times vary by transaction, but many closings in Hidden Valley Lake occur within a few weeks from contract to recording. Working with a closing attorney helps align deadlines with lender requirements, ensure accurate documents, and reduce last-minute issues.
You may need: the purchase agreement, disclosures, the title report, HOA documents if applicable, loan documents, identification, and funds for closing. Your attorney will guide you on any additional items specific to the property.
Title insurance is not required by law in California, but it is highly recommended to protect against title defects. Some lenders require it as a condition of financing. Your closing attorney can explain options and help you obtain appropriate coverage.
Closing costs include recording fees, title insurance, lender charges, escrow fees, and, in some cases, transfer taxes. Your attorney can provide a precise breakdown for your transaction.
Power of attorney at closing is possible in some situations, but lenders or counties may have requirements. Your attorney can help determine if it’s appropriate. We can prepare the necessary documents to ensure a smooth process.
If title issues arise, the closing team will work to resolve them, which may involve additional documentation or negotiations. Title insurance or lien releases may be needed to move the closing forward.
Typically the seller pays a portion of the closing costs, but arrangements vary by transaction. Buyers and sellers often share specific fees. Your agent and attorney can explain the exact breakdown for your closing.
After closing, documents are recorded with the county and ownership transfers are completed. You will receive copies and the title is updated. If you financed, you’ll receive loan payoff statements and title insurance details.
